What Is This Tool?
This converter allows you to translate volume values from dekastere, equal to ten cubic metres, into ccf, which represents hundred cubic feet. It bridges metric-based forestry and bulk storage volumes with units typical in water and natural gas billing.

Frequently Asked Questions
-
What is a dekastere?
-
A dekastere is a non-SI metric unit of volume equal to ten cubic metres or ten steres.
-
What does ccf stand for and where is it used?
-
Ccf stands for hundred cubic feet and is commonly used by utilities to measure water and natural gas volumes.

Key Terminology
-
Dekastere
-
A non-SI metric unit of volume equal to ten cubic metres, commonly used in forestry and bulk storage.
-
Ccf
-
A volume unit equal to one hundred cubic feet, used primarily by utilities for water and natural gas measurement.
-
Stere
-
A unit denoting one cubic metre, historically used for measuring stacked firewood volumes.
